Bill Summary
A bill for an act relating to public safety; appropriating money for mental health services and outdoor activities for law enforcement officers, firefighters, and emergency medical services personnel.
AI Summary
This bill appropriates $500,000 total ($250,000 in fiscal years 2026 and 2027) from the general fund to the Minnesota Commissioner of Public Safety to provide a grant to Hometown Hero Outdoors, a nonprofit organization based in Stillwater, Minnesota. The grant is specifically designed to support present and former law enforcement officers, firefighters, and emergency medical services personnel through two primary mechanisms: funding outdoor recreational activities and providing mental health services. The broader goals of this funding are to promote positive mental health, facilitate interactions with mental health professionals, enhance the quality of life and longevity for these public safety personnel, and provide public education. The bill aims to ensure that the organization can continue supporting individuals who are currently serving or have served in these critical public safety professions, recognizing the unique mental health challenges they may face in their challenging and often stressful work environments.
